Transforming Children into Spiritual Champions

Transforming Children into Spiritual Champions

Author: George Barna

Publisher: Baker Books

Published: 2013-02-18

Total Pages: 143

ISBN-13: 1441223649

DOWNLOAD EBOOK

No one can deny our culture is opposed to Christian values, and the influences bombarding our children's moral development are difficult to contend with. But few parents and church leaders realize that a child's moral development is set by the age of nine. It is therefore critical to start developing a child's biblical worldview from the very earliest years of life. The problem is complex: parents who themselves did not receive early spiritual training leave their children's training to the church. Yet the church often focuses on older children. The answer is for churches to come alongside parents to provide them biblical worldview training, parenting information, and counseling that will equip them to help their children become the spiritually mature church of tomorrow. This helpful and hopeful book unpacks just how to develop this kind of dynamic church/parent relationship and includes profiles of churches that are effectively ministering to children and winning the war for their hearts and minds.

Raising Spiritual Champions

Raising Spiritual Champions

Author: George Barna

Publisher:

Published: 2023-09-04

Total Pages: 0

ISBN-13: 9781957616476

DOWNLOAD EBOOK

***#1 AMAZON BESTSELLER IN CHRISTIAN SOCIAL STUDIES*** As Christians, the ultimate goal for your child is to embody the characteristics of Christ―the Son of God sent to demonstrate His desire for us. But how can you realistically help your child imitate the life of Jesus Christ? In Raising Spiritual Champions, renowned researcher and bestselling author George Barna reveals that who your child will be as an adult is essentially determined by the age of 13―their core beliefs, morals, values, desires, and lifestyle. Raising your child is an exciting opportunity to influence a life, but it is also a daunting assignment. Parents have the God-given responsibility―and privilege―to guide the development of their children, a responsibility that cannot be delegated to schools, churches, media, or community organizations. Based on extensive national research, Barna outlines a biblical approach to raising children with the "Seven Cornerstones of a Biblical Worldview." Carefully blending scripture and sociological insights, Barna explains how parents can lead their children to: * Establish their God-given identity * Develop appropriate life priorities * Grasp the source and significance of truth * Embrace an eternal perspective * Properly define life success * Find compelling meaning and purpose Raising Spiritual Champions is a dynamic, Bible-based, research-supported guide for the parents of tomorrow's Christian Church. This book was published by Arizona Christian University Press in partnership with Fedd Books.
